New Features in Windows Server 2025 Datacenter

Windows Server 2025 Datacenter introduces several innovative features that enhance security, performance, virtualization, and hybrid cloud capabilities. These features are unique compared to previous versions (e.g., Windows Server 2022, 2019) and cater to enterprises with extensive virtualization and datacenter needs. Below are the key new features:

1. Enhanced Virtualization and Hyper-V Capabilities

  1. GPU Partitioning (GPU-P): Allows sharing a single GPU across multiple virtual machines (VMs) with support for live migration and failover clustering. This is ideal for AI, machine learning, and graphics-intensive workloads, a feature not available in earlier versions.
  2. Dynamic Processor Compatibility: Enables live migration of VMs between Hyper-V hosts with different CPU types by dynamically adjusting to compatible CPU features, eliminating the need for identical processors across hosts.
  3. Increased VM Scalability: Supports up to 2,048 virtual processors and 29.7 terabytes of RAM for Generation 2 VMs, significantly enhancing scalability for large-scale virtualized environments.

2. Advanced Security Enhancements

  1. Next-Generation Active Directory (AD): Introduces a functional level 10 with a 32k database page size (up from 8k), improving scalability and performance for large AD deployments. New security protocols and encryption hardening protect against evolving threats.
  2. Delegated Managed Service Accounts (dMSA): A new account type that minimizes security risks by automating password management and delegating specific permissions for resource access, reducing manual intervention compared to traditional service accounts.
  3. Credential Guard Enabled by Default: Provides enhanced protection against credential theft attacks, a feature now standard in Windows Server 2025 Datacenter.
  4. SMB Hardening with QUIC: Extends SMB over QUIC to both Standard and Datacenter editions (previously exclusive to Azure Edition). This enables secure, low-latency, encrypted file share access over the internet, with protections against man-in-the-middle, relay, and spoofing attacks.
  5. Windows Local Administrator Password Solution (LAPS) Improvements: Introduces new Password Complexity settings for generating readable passphrases using standardized word lists, enhancing usability while maintaining security.

3. Hybrid Cloud and Azure Integration

  1. Azure Arc Setup as Feature on Demand: Installed by default with a user-friendly wizard and system tray icon, simplifying onboarding to Azure Arc for managing on-premises servers with Azure services like Update Manager and Change Tracking.
  2. Hotpatching via Azure Arc: A subscription-based feature (in preview) that delivers security updates with minimal reboots, reducing downtime for on-premises and multicloud environments. This is a significant leap from previous versions, which relied on traditional patching methods.
  3. Pay-as-You-Go (PAYG) Licensing: A new subscription-based licensing model tied to Azure Arc, allowing organizations to pay per core-hour for temporary workloads without needing perpetual licenses. This is exclusive to Windows Server 2025 and not available in prior versions.

4. Performance and Management Improvements

  1. SMB Compression with LZ4 Algorithm: Adds support for the industry-standard LZ4 compression algorithm (in addition to existing XPRESS, LZNT1, and others), improving file transfer performance over networks.
  2. Modernized User Interface: Adopts the Windows 11 design language with a Mica-designed Task Manager, customizable Start menu with administrative tools, and native Bluetooth support for wireless peripherals, enhancing the desktop experience.
  3. DTrace for Real-Time Monitoring: Introduces DTrace, a powerful tool for real-time system diagnostics and performance monitoring, not available in previous Windows Server versions.
  4. Enhanced File Compression: Supports ZIP, 7z, and TAR formats natively, streamlining file management for administrators.
  5. Replication Priority Order: Allows administrators to prioritize replication with specific partners for Active Directory naming contexts, offering greater flexibility in managing replication scenarios.


5. Removal of Legacy Features for Modernization

  1. Legacy Feature Removal: Removes outdated components like Data Encryption Standard (DES), NTLMv1 authentication, SMTP Server, and WordPad to reduce security risks and maintenance overhead, aligning with modern security standards.

These features collectively make Windows Server 2025 Datacenter a future-ready platform, with significant advancements in virtualization, security, and hybrid cloud integration compared to Windows Server 2022 and earlier.


Pricing and Licensing Analysis: India and US

Windows Server 2025 Datacenter uses a core-based licensing model, requiring licenses for all physical cores in the server (minimum 16 cores per server) and Client Access Licenses (CALs) for each user or device accessing the server. Pricing varies by region due to currency exchange rates, local taxes, and reseller margins. Below is an analysis of pricing and licensing costs in India and the US, based on general trends and available information.

United States

  1. Datacenter Edition Base Price: Approximately $6,771 for a 16-core license. This covers unlimited virtualization rights, making it cost-effective for enterprises with large VM deployments.
  2. Additional Core Licenses: For servers with more than 16 cores, additional licenses are required. A 2-core pack costs around $400–$500, and a 16-core pack may cost $2,500–$3,000, depending on the reseller.
  3. Client Access Licenses (CALs):
  4. User/Device CAL: ~$30–$50 per user or device.
  5. Remote Desktop Services (RDS) CAL: ~$100–$150 per user or device for terminal server functionality.
  6. Pay-as-You-Go (PAYG) Option: A new subscription model priced at approximately $33.58 per core per month (~$0.046 per core per hour) via Azure Arc. No CALs are required for PAYG, except for RDS CALs if used as a terminal server.
  7. Total Cost Example: For a 32-core server with 50 users:
  8. Base license (16 cores): $6,771
  9. Additional 16-core pack: ~$2,500
  10. 50 User CALs: 50 × $40 = $2,000
  11. Total: ~$11,271 (one-time perpetual license) or ~$1,074/month for PAYG (32 cores × $33.58).
  12. Price Increase: Microsoft has announced a 10% price hike for on-premises server products effective July 1, 2025, which may increase the base price to ~$7,448 for a 16-core license.

Key Considerations

  1. US vs. India Pricing: India pricing is generally higher in relative terms due to currency conversion, import duties, and local taxes (e.g., GST). However, Microsoft partners in India often offer competitive discounts for bulk or enterprise purchases.
  2. Perpetual vs. PAYG: The perpetual license is cost-effective for long-term use (e.g., >3 years), while PAYG suits temporary or seasonal workloads. PAYG requires an Azure subscription and internet connectivity, which may add minor costs.
  3. CAL Requirements: Both regions require CALs for perpetual licenses, increasing costs for large user bases. PAYG eliminates standard CAL costs, which is a significant saving for organizations with many users/devices.
  4. Price Hike Impact: The upcoming 10% increase (July 2025) makes purchasing before the hike advantageous for perpetual licenses.
